    Power issue 2019 TRX20

    Fished a tournament last night and on blast off power went off like the main power button was pushed, then happened twice more during the night while fishing. When power turns off you can go to main power button and it will come back on immediately. Initially thought it may be the toggle breaker below the dry box in the battery compartment but don’t know if it’s possible for this breaker to lose power intermittently and not remain off if tripped. I know some of these were faulty and had to be replaced. Just curious if anyone has experienced this that can point me to a shortcut as these are hard issues to diagnose.

    Check the ground wire connected to the grounding buss. On my 2017 21TRX, the grounding buss is located in the rear battery compartment on the starboard side. I had a similar issue happen once, it was a loose ground. I tightened the nut on the post lug and have never had the issue again. Good luck, chasing wiring issues is a pain PITA.

    ****UPDATE**** Hey guys, just an update, the problem was my main breaker. The on/off switch was weak and the day box that sits above it was moving it enough when it shifted to power everything down but not flip the switch completely. Replaced with a different type of breaker and problem solved.....thank you for the input.
